English architect John Soane created dramatic and unpredictable buildings that continue to inspire architects worldwide. This biography tells the story of the self-made, irascible architect's turbulent life and the remarkable buildings he designed, including the Bank of England. 75 colour plates, 160 b&w illustrationsPRIZES:Shortlisted for James Tait Black Memorial Book Prizes: Biography 2000.
